BYR-ZP High-Temperature Guided Pressure Type Level Transmitter: Is the stainless steel cable cartridge design more durable?
Added to Favorites:125

Under high-temperature operating conditions, the durability of the BYR-ZP guided pressure type level transmitter directly affects production safety and cost control. Can its innovatively adopted stainless steel cable barrel design significantly improve corrosion resistance and mechanical strength compared with traditional structures? This article will provide an in-depth analysis of the material and process differences among similar products such as CS20LG and FT3000A3, offering key performance comparison data for procurement decisions.


I. Core Advantages of the Stainless Steel Cable Barrel Design


The BYR-ZP high-temperature guided pressure type level transmitter adopts a 316L stainless steel cable barrel structure. Compared with traditional carbon steel or plastic housings, its corrosion resistance is improved by more than 300%. In strong acid and alkali environments such as refineries and chemical reaction vessels, similar products such as CS20LG and FT3000A3 often suffer medium penetration due to housing corrosion, while BYR-ZP's sealed welding process combined with an IP68 protection rating can withstand 3000 hours of salt spray testing under 5MPa pressure. Actual cases show that after three years of use, a chlor-alkali enterprise found cable sheath embrittlement in the STB-618 model, while under the same conditions, BYR-ZP's metal bellows structure still maintained deformation accuracy at the 0.05mm level.


II. Comparative Performance Tests in High-Temperature Environments


By comparing the performance of six mainstream products such as AP203 and BOS-H208-C under 450℃ operating conditions, BYR-ZP demonstrates significant advantages: its built-in aluminum oxide ceramic thermal insulation layer can control the core sensor temperature within 150℃, while YKKT-1D shows signal drift of up to ±1.2%FS under the same conditions. Test data indicate that the stainless steel barrel is better matched with the sensor chip in terms of thermal expansion coefficient(14.9×10-6/℃), reducing thermal stress error by 60% compared with the composite material used by TK-HB. Accelerated aging tests in the Xi'an Shenghongchuang laboratory verified that ZRN702B dropped to Class 0.5 accuracy after 800 thermal cycles, while BYR-ZP still maintained the Class 0.2 standard.

IV. In-Depth Analysis of Industry Application Scenarios


In deaerator water level control in thermal power plants, BYR-ZP's fast response characteristic(<50ms)is 2 times better than TK-HB, effectively preventing "false water level" accidents. Comparative tests in a nuclear power project showed that when steam pressure changes abruptly, the stainless steel structure of SE600 produces a 0.8% measurement deviation, while BYR-ZP controls fluctuation within 0.2% through its patented pressure guide hole design. This stability is particularly critical in GMP-certified production lines in the pharmaceutical industry, and its 316L material is FDA certified, preventing leachables from contaminating the culture medium.
